html5自適應(yīng)字體(html5調(diào)整字體大小)
1,輸入positionfixedtop0left0將整個(gè)div固定在屏幕的頂部和左側(cè)2輸入width100%height100%min-width1000px這個(gè)可以適合div的高度和寬度,而min-width是為了實(shí)現(xiàn)讓屏幕寬度在1000px以?xún)?nèi)時(shí),div的大小保持不變3輸入backgroundsize coverwebkitbackgroundsize;頭部要加的是這個(gè),放在ltheadlthead標(biāo)簽里,這是初始化手機(jī)屏幕的ltmeta name=quotviewportquot content=quotwidth=devicewidth, initialscale=10, maximumscale=10, userscalable=noquot 你寫(xiě)的這段是要放在所有css樣式后邊的,以防止樣式覆蓋這段的意思是在電腦屏或者其他屏上你顯示的是一個(gè);一使用textarea標(biāo)簽進(jìn)行多行文本的輸入有很多限制,比如不能實(shí)現(xiàn)高度自適應(yīng),會(huì)出現(xiàn)難看的滾動(dòng)條等問(wèn)題HTML5中添加了一個(gè)新屬性contenteditable,該屬性可以讓input,textarea以外的不可編輯的標(biāo)簽具備可編輯功能用法如下contenteditable=quottruequot當(dāng)屬性值為true的時(shí)候,可編輯標(biāo)簽內(nèi)可以寫(xiě)入標(biāo)簽,對(duì)于;2打開(kāi)HTML文件所在的文件夾,雙擊文件,跳轉(zhuǎn)到瀏覽器 3改變?yōu)g覽器大小,發(fā)現(xiàn)圖片沒(méi)有變化,顯示不全 4在所在文件夾下,新建一個(gè)樣式文件,命名為 autocss,代碼如下 5在HTML文件中加上對(duì)樣式文件的引用,返回文件夾,雙擊HTML文件,發(fā)現(xiàn)瀏覽器的變化會(huì)引著圖片一起變化,自適應(yīng)屏幕的大小 工;瀏覽器部分能夠顯示的最小字體未12px,當(dāng)移動(dòng)端頁(yè)面寬度為320px時(shí),要保證最小字體為12px,那么在1080px的設(shè)計(jì)圖中,最小字體應(yīng)當(dāng)為42px代碼實(shí)例ltstyle type=quottextcssquot html fontsize 42px ltstyle4 按照設(shè)計(jì)圖的像素進(jìn)行開(kāi)發(fā) 按照正常網(wǎng)頁(yè)開(kāi)發(fā)流程,進(jìn)行網(wǎng)頁(yè);這篇文章主要介紹了HTML5 移動(dòng)頁(yè)面自適應(yīng)手機(jī)屏幕四類(lèi)方法總結(jié),非常具有實(shí)用價(jià)值,需要的朋友可以參考下1使用meta標(biāo)簽viewportH5移動(dòng)端頁(yè)面自適應(yīng)普遍使用的方法,理論上講使用這個(gè)標(biāo)簽是可以適應(yīng)所有尺寸的屏幕的,但是各設(shè)備對(duì)該標(biāo)簽的解釋方式及支持程度不同造成了不能兼容所有瀏覽器或系統(tǒng) viewport。
首先你要在html頁(yè)面頭部加上下面的代碼viewportquot,不懂可以百度content=quot,一些小的模塊可以用固定尺寸meta , name=quot再就是css中要應(yīng)用到媒體查詢(xún),不能不用固定尺寸lt,其次你要把頁(yè)面中的寬度修改為百分比width=devicewidth ,也就是@mediainitialscale=1quot超文本標(biāo)記語(yǔ)言,標(biāo)準(zhǔn);在文檔流中,DIV的高度默認(rèn)就是根據(jù)內(nèi)容的高度自適應(yīng)的如果是想適配不同設(shè)備的窗口大小,可以設(shè)置百分比或者通過(guò)position定位,然后設(shè)置top和bottom值再或者利用css3的flexbox布局,設(shè)置父級(jí)的display為flex,方向?yàn)榭v的,然后設(shè)置其flex1。
逗自適應(yīng)網(wǎng)頁(yè)設(shè)計(jì)地的核心,就是CSS3引入的 Media Query模塊它的意思就是,自動(dòng)探測(cè)屏幕寬度,然后加載相應(yīng)的CSS文件上面的代碼意思是,如果屏幕寬度小于400像素maxdevicewidth 400px,就加載tinyScreencss文件如果屏幕寬度在400像素到600像素之間,則加載smallScreencss文件除了用html標(biāo)簽。
自適應(yīng)網(wǎng)站是一種網(wǎng)頁(yè)設(shè)計(jì)技術(shù),它能根據(jù)設(shè)備屏幕的大小和寬度自動(dòng)調(diào)整布局,適應(yīng)在不同終端設(shè)備上的顯示這種設(shè)計(jì)被稱(chēng)為響應(yīng)式,是一種HTML5的新技術(shù)自適應(yīng)網(wǎng)站具有以下優(yōu)勢(shì)1它使用一套代碼來(lái)支持PC端手機(jī)端和IPAD端,無(wú)需額外的代碼2只需要一個(gè)后臺(tái)賬號(hào)管理,簡(jiǎn)化了管理流程3避免了;aa display flex 使用flex布局,可以輕易獲得水平布局 alignitems center 垂直方向居中 justifycontent center 水平方向居中 height 200px border 1px solid #000aa1, aa2, aa3 flex 1 padding 2px height 100pxaa1 div;用html5+css3制作自適應(yīng)屏寬網(wǎng)頁(yè),字體大小就會(huì)隨屏寬的大小而大小。
在css中定義一個(gè)控制embed的div樣式, 自適應(yīng)可以利用的浮動(dòng)元素的尺寸可以通過(guò)margin來(lái)調(diào)整,然后讓body的高度要設(shè)為100%,這樣內(nèi)部的div的高度設(shè)為100%才有效,寬度嘛不用管他,div默認(rèn)就是自適應(yīng)寬度的 東莞匯鑫。
paddingbottom5625% 為什么要用paddingbottom來(lái)維持169這個(gè)通俗點(diǎn)說(shuō) 就是現(xiàn)在 寬度是1, 結(jié)果需要得到916,求高度 === 結(jié)果就是05625,而且視頻要求自適應(yīng),height設(shè)置百分比是相當(dāng)于父容器來(lái)說(shuō)的,而padding是自身的 所以要設(shè)置padding而不是height;html5中是通過(guò)css3的backgroundsize來(lái)控制自適應(yīng)的直接在圖片代碼里面設(shè)置style,例如ltimg src=quotxxxjpgquot style=quotmaxwidth100%quot2要么給圖片統(tǒng)一一個(gè)class名例如responseimg,然后在css文件里面設(shè)置這個(gè)class html5 萬(wàn)維網(wǎng)的核心語(yǔ)言標(biāo)準(zhǔn)通用標(biāo)記語(yǔ)言下的一個(gè)應(yīng)用超文本標(biāo)記語(yǔ)言HTML的。
掃描二維碼推送至手機(jī)訪(fǎng)問(wèn)。
版權(quán)聲明:本文由飛速云SEO網(wǎng)絡(luò)優(yōu)化推廣發(fā)布,如需轉(zhuǎn)載請(qǐng)注明出處。